Ordinals
beta
Sat 1310144227363886
decimal
314057.1727363886
degree
0°104057′1577″1727363886‴
percentile
62.38782041928786%
name
eolhxlbhlqx
cycle
0
epoch
1
period
155
block
314057
offset
1727363886
timestamp
2014-08-05 08:29:35 UTC
rarity
common
prev
next